研究実績の概要

In the second year of the Kakenhi project, we published two papers: Chiuchiu, Tu and Pigolotti Phys. Rev. Lett. 2019, Chiuchiu, Ferrare and Pigolotti PRE 2019. The first paper studies error correction and its fluctuations as a stochastic phenomenon. The second paper describes error correction using a continuous stochastic model.
In the last year of the project, our main objective is to complete the study of the optimal tradeoff between speed, dissipation, and accuracy in error-correcting reactions. This will be the most ambitious goal of this Kakenhi project

理由

We published two papers, including one in a high impact journal (Physical Review Letters). We also obtained promising results on optimization of replication reactions. These results make us confident that we will be able to complete the proposed research plan during the third year of the project. On the other hand, our project on connecting mutation signatures with properties of replicating machine has progressed rather slowly due to technical difficulties. We anyhow expected that this project could involve higher risks and was likely to take more time. Overall, the status of the project is very satisfactory.

今後の研究の推進方策

During the last year of the KAKENHI project, we will focus on finalizing our work on optimization of networks replicating information. We spent a significant amount of time during this year to develop an efficient algorithm that optimizes these networks according to given scores. The algorithm now is complete and we are obtaining the first results. The rest of the year will be devoted to produce extensive results for general replicating networks, analyzing these results, and writing a paper on these results. We expect this work to have a significant impact on the community working on this problem.
